Flexibility training is an important component of physical fitness for everyday active people as well as athletes and performers. Guidelines for a flexibility training program suggest stretching with a minimum frequency of three days per week. Flexibility training offers athletes, professional and amateur alike, the ability to improve their performance through increased range of motion and decreased injury risk.

How we structure our classes
- Rhythmic Gymnastics Based Warm Up
- PNF partner stretching (proprioceptive neuromuscular facilitation)
- Dynamic stretching including Kicks
- Passive stretching including Splits, Supersplits & Progressions towards
- Back extensions including Backbends & variations
- Theraband exercises and light leg weights to improve ROM
- Gymnastics based core strength
- Injury Prevention Exercises from Pilates (Especially for the Hips)
- Plyometric Jump Training (optional)
